#bd8fdc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d8fdc is composed of 74.1% red, 56.1%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.1% cyan, 35%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 71.2%. #bd8fdc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7b1fb9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#bd8fdc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050208 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d8fdc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b1ba is the less saturated color, while #c46dfe is the most saturated one.
